Transaction aa95600ea4ef2e3100b748f40b4e681f5f70c2ac37b69428872a228bb0386420
1 Input
1 Output
-
aa95600ea4ef2e3100b748f40b4e681f5f70c2ac37b69428872a228bb0386420:0
- value
- 585052
- script pubkey
- OP_0 OP_PUSHBYTES_20 18ce505107bcb5962f3d0bdb3dc3dd417bee629d
- address
- bc1qrr89q5g8hj6evteap0dnms7ag9a7uc5aya8v02